Description of Hrabeyia

provided by BioPedia
Monomorphic, diplokaryotic; meronts divide by binary fission; isolated diplokaryotic sporonts with nuclei of unequal size lie in direct contact with host cell cytoplasm.; division by binary fission produce diplokaryotic sporoblasts; spores, 6 x 3 µm, are elongate ovoid and bear a gnarled caudal appendage, 18 µm long, covered by the exospore material and consisting of electron transparent material compartmentalized by exospore layers; nuclei are of unequal size; polaroplast has a uniformly flocculated structure, without lamellar component - although these characteristics are questioned; the polar tube tapers gradually from the tip toward the posterior end, forming 7-10 coils arranged in one rank; type species H. xerkophora Lom and Dykova, 1990 in coelomocytes of Nais christinae (Oligochaeta, Naididae).
